What you'll see and do
The Former Hokkaido Government Office, or Red Brick Office (Akarenga Chosha), is one of Sapporo’s most iconic landmarks. Built over 120 years ago, it once served as the administrative headquarters of Hokkaido after the pioneering era began in the late 19th century, symbolizing the island’s development and Japan’s frontier spirit. Its distinctive red brick exterior has remained intact since construction, making it a true witness to Hokkaido’s history. Inside, restored interiors recreate its days as a government office, complete with a grand staircase. Today, it functions as a museum with exhibits on pioneering history, the Ainu people, the building’s architecture, and the Northern Territories. Displays also highlight the culture and specialties of Hokkaido’s towns. Located in central Sapporo, the Red Brick Office is easy to access and stands as both a cultural attraction and a symbol of Hokkaido’s heritage.
